The Victor Hugo Library
In which Jean Valjean, pursued and desperate, discovers a grim and forsaken building on the edges of the Rue Polonceau, its heavy iron bars and decaying walls offering both refuge and frustration in equal measure. As he seeks a means of concealment from prying eyes, he finds himself confronted by the deceptive façade of a door that conceals no entrance but a solid, impenetrable stone wall.
